Mysterious Galaxy phone: Samsung manager confirms its existence

There is wild speculation online about a Galaxy cell phone that has not yet been announced. Now a Samsung manager has confirmed the existence of the device.

For years, the Galaxy S series has consisted of three models. In addition to the basic version, Samsung will also be releasing a Plus and an Ultra version in spring. In recent years, Samsung has added a so-called fan edition, or FE for short, to these months later. The Galaxy S23 FE, which is actually due, shone with its absence at Samsung’s Unpacked event in July.

In Seoul, Samsung only introduced the Z Fold 5, Z Flip 5, Galaxy Watch 6 and Tab S9. That fueled rumors about the future of the FE series. In the past few months, the Galaxy S23 FE had been declared dead by many leakers before new leaks appeared again. Now a Samsung manager is said to have confirmed the existence of the cell phone to the AndroidAuthority website.

Galaxy S23 FE is a work in progress

In an interview with Justin Hume, Vice-President of mobile at Samsung South Africa, the online magazine asked whether there wasn’t a “big” gap in the portfolio between the S23 and the Galaxy A54. The manager replied with a laugh: “There’s an FE-sized gap at the moment.” A corresponding announcement will be made soon, according to AndroidAuthority.

It remains to be seen whether the cell phone will appear in Europe and specifically in Germany. Rumor has it that Samsung will only release it in selected markets.
